âDo not have sufficient funds to operate in 26-27 seasonâ Talks with potential investors âhave fallen awayâ Durham, the Womenâs Super League 2 side, have issued an urgent plea for funding and warned that they will have to âcease operationsâ if they cannot find fresh investment within the next 21 days. The independently run club, who are not affiliated to a professional menâs side, have been competing in the second tier of the English womenâs football pyramid for 12 years, but say their owners can âno longer keep paceâ with the womenâs gameâs development.
